#634b23 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#634b23 is composed of 38.8% red, 29.4%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.2% magenta, 64.6%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 37.5 degrees, a saturation of 47.8% and a lightness of 26.3%. #634b23 color hex could be obtained by blending #c69646 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

● #634b23 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#634b23 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#634b23 has RGB values of R:99, G:75, B:35 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.24, Y:0.65,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6507299.

Shades and Tints of #634b23
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0904 is the darkest color, while #fefef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#634b23
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#444342 is the less saturated color, while #825304 is the most saturated one.
